Anomalous conductivity dependence of plasticized PVC for different modificator "A" concentrations and film thicknesses
arXiv:1103.5975
Abstract
The dependences of electrical conductivity of plasticized PVC films on mass fraction of plasticizer "A" and the film thickness are experimentally investigated. Non-monotonic dependence of conductivity on the concentration of plasticizer and strongly nonlinear dependence of the resistance of the film on its thickness are found. Possibility of construction of the models describing received results is shown and also discussed.
